Bud Light VP Behind Mulvany Collab On Leave Of Absence

  • The recent partnership between the American beer company brand Bud Light and transgender influencer Dylan Mulvaney sparked immediate and very public backlash among some buyers and resulted in stock declines.
  • Alissa Heinerscheid, Bud Light’s vice president of marketing behind the campaign, or partnership, will reportedly be replaced by Todd Allen.
  • A spokesperson for Bud Light’s parent company, Anheuser-Busch InBev, on Saturday did not directly confirm the leave of absence to the Associated Press but said Allen as vice president of Bud Light will report directly to Benoit Garbe, U.S. chief marketing officer.
  • The campaign unofficially stated April, when Mulvaney, who has more than 10.8 million social media followers, posted a video on Instagram of her opening a special edition can of Bud Light, with her face on it with the hashtag #budlightpartner.
  • Anheuser-Busch InBev’s stock that trades in the United States is down 1.8% since Mulvaney’s April 1 video.
